Ford Fashions Old Plastic Bottles into Sporty Seat Covers

With green initiatives and environmental concerns in the news every day, Pearson Ford is sure our drivers are aware that one of the biggest environmental offenders is the plastic water bottle. Presently, less than a third of plastic bottles in the U.S. get recycled, even though they can be put to great post-consumer use. Ford is aware of these issues, and the company has taken its dedication to green initiatives to a new level by recycling around two million of these plastic bottles (in partnership with the REPREVE company) to create seat materials for the upcoming Ford Focus, specifically its Electric variant.

Each new Ford Focus Electric will use twenty-two recycled bottles to make these seats- one portion of the Focus' new interior made with 100 percent clean technology. Water bottles will predominantly be collected from the North American International Auto Show and the Consumer Electronics Show, which will further decrease the automobile industry's impact on the environment. However, though the number of bottles at 2 million seems like a good portion of the bottles being used, it represents only five minutes worth of water bottles being consumed in America every day.
